Output 95923a3aaeb4ee70f385dfbafcf89d57131b13da8639ca5b2891ac1b5352c7af:19

value
2656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 783d2087938a4243715913a052704c3455a25250 OP_EQUAL
address
DG6rrTi1aPAvgLB4r82cPajzoW293tMNbe
transaction
95923a3aaeb4ee70f385dfbafcf89d57131b13da8639ca5b2891ac1b5352c7af
spent
true